begin process at 2010 02 10 05:00:36
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Archive Java

 > 

Archives

 > 

Divers

 > 

Création d'un composant


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

Création d'un composant

lundi 21 avril 2003 à 01:30:08 | Création d'un composant

ghilliesuit

Salut,
Je suis actuellement en train de créer un composant java du type bouton en forme de losange. Ma classe losange dérive de la classe Component.
La base d'un Component sur laquelle je veux dessiner mon losange est de format rectangulaire, j'aimerais savoir s'il était possible de changer la forme de base d'un Component afin d'avoir un losange ou une autre forme (rond, ellipse).

Merci d'avance !
Ciao
lundi 21 avril 2003 à 13:42:09 | Re : Création d'un composant

CoreBreaker

Je pense qu'un bouton issu de java.awt.Button ne peut pas redéfinir sa forme.
Mais que swing peut le faire (javax.swing.JButton) en redéfinissant la classe javax.swing.plaf.UIButton, en faisant:

public class UIMyButton extends javax.swing.plaf.UIButton
{
...
public UIMyButton(javax.swing.JButton b)
{
...
installUI(b);
...
}
...
}

public class MyButton extends javax.swing.JButton
{
...
public MyButton()
{
...
new UIMybutton(this);
...
}
...
}

Core Breaker


-------------------------------
Réponse au message :
-------------------------------

> Salut,
> Je suis actuellement en train de créer un composant java du type bouton en forme de losange. Ma classe losange dérive de la classe Component.
> La base d'un Component sur laquelle je veux dessiner mon losange est de format rectangulaire, j'aimerais savoir s'il était possible de changer la forme de base d'un Component afin d'avoir un losange ou une autre forme (rond, ellipse).
>
> Merci d'avance !
> Ciao


Cette discussion est classée dans : composant, création, forme, component, losange


Répondre à ce message

Sujets en rapport avec ce message

Création fichier distant avec un chemin sous forme d'URL [ par gdu ] Bonjour,Dans une page JSP je désire créer un fichier avec un path sous la forme :"http://........" , forme qui ne semble pas être acceptée par :File t Création de composant [ par ghilliesuit ] Salut, Je suis toujours en train de vouloir créer un composant Java en forme de losange. Lorsqu'on crée de nouveau objet Button et qu'on les insère da Création d'une image avec un composant [ par chgw ] Bonjour,J'ai un composant que je voudrais transformer en image. Est-ce possible? Si oui comment?Merci d'avance. comment creer un composant graphique javabeans [ par crv ] Bonjour,je cherche deseperement un tutorial, des conseils, ou quoi que se soit qui me permette à developper un composant graphique (style bouton). J'a msg ds la barre d'etat lors du survol d'un composant [ par OliV_25 ] lu a tousje suis entrain de faire une application ac barre d'etat et je voudrais afficher des msg dedans en fonction du composant séléctionner, mais g Création dynamique de texfield [ par pr0ph3t3u5 ] Bonjour,Mon problème est le suivant.Je dois créer des texfield en fonction d'un nombre bien précis.Par exemple, si l'utilisater en veux 3, j'aimerais création d'Applet [ par Bison_Ravi_33 ] salut tout le monde.j'ai installé le JSE 1.5.0-beta2 et j'utilise BDK 1.1 pour visualiser les beans que je crée.Cependant, j'arrive pas à créer des Ap création d'un formulaire e-commerce avec panier [ par ajcom ] Bonjour,Je dois ajouter à mon site ajcommunication.com une page formulaire destinée à la vente de produits brodée. Cette page doit comporter les mêmes Changer la taille d'un composant d'une frame lors d'un resize [ par DirigeableMoue ] Bonjour,J'ai chercher sur le forum mais je n'ai aps trouver la réponse.J'ai tout simplement une frame avec un JPanel contenant un JScrollPane contena Création d'un paint en java... [ par ralkif ] Slt !Bon voila mon problème...voila l'intitulé de ma classe principale :class Dessin extends JFrame implements MouseListener, MouseMotionListenerje dé


Nos sponsors


Sondage...

CalendriCode

Février 2010
LMMJVSD
1234567
891011121314
15161718192021
22232425262728

Consulter la suite du CalendriCode

 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,796 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ales